Nike Spotlights 20 Universities With New Air Zoom Pegasus 38 Pack
From Arizona and Alabama to USC and LSU.




















Nike supplies uniforms, footwear and more to dozens of NCAA Division 1 athletic programs, and now Nike Running is spotlighting 20 select schools with special iterations of the Air Zoom Pegasus 38. Representing (in order of the images above) the Tennessee Volunteers, North Carolina Tar Heels, Oklahoma State Cowboys, Kentucky Wildcats, LSU Tigers, Alabama Crimson Tide, Ohio State Buckeyes, Virginia Cavaliers, Oregon Ducks, Oregon State Beavers, Oklahoma Sooners, West Virginia Mountaineers, Penn State Nittany Lions, Florida State Seminoles, Texas Longhorns, Clemson Tigers, Georgia Bulldogs, Southern California Trojans, Florida Gators and Arizona Wildcats, each shoe combines team tones and branded hits for a look that’s full of school pride.
Though colors are very different from team to team, each of the 20 shoes uses similar colorblocking — namely one of its school’s shades on the forefoot and the other on the heel. Each also places a small school logo on the lateral heel, directly behind the rear point of the large midfoot Swoosh. There’s also a repeating print on each shoe’s insole, a dash of color on the midsole, small Swooshes below the medial heel and detailing on the lace keepers. From a performance standpoint, each features a midfoot webbing system for lockdown and boasts a React midsole loaded with a forefoot Zoom Air unit for a feel that’s both soft and snappy.
All 20 collegiate colorways of the Nike Air Zoom Pegasus 38 will release on the Nike webstore soon. Each is priced at $130 USD.
